BFAM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

279 of the 6,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Bright Horizons (BFAM)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$5.7B — up 25% from $4.57B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 39 funds closed out of BFAM and 36 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 101 trimmed existing stakes and 101 added.

The largest buyer was William Blair Investment Management, adding an estimated $109M. The largest seller was Mirova US, exiting entirely with an estimated $54.7M sold.
